Explore this Property

Discover an extraordinary retreat 17.023 acres of pristine, untouched beauty nestled along frontage on the Black River's main branch. This breathtaking sanctuary is a true masterpiece of nature, featuring rolling ravines, dunes, serene wetlands, and a seasonal creek that gently winds its way into the riverbed. Teeming with abundant wildlife, this property is home to deer, turkey, otters, salmon, wood ducks, and elegant sandhill cranes, creating an unparalleled haven for nature lovers and outdoor enthusiasts. This is a once-in-a-lifetime opportunity to craft your private riverside sanctuary. With multiple elevated building sites offering breathtaking panoramic river views, the possibilities are endless whether you envision a luxurious estate, a secluded getaway, or a premier development opportunity. Pullman, MI 49450

This community’s employment is highest in the agriculture and healthcare practitioners industries. The area’s overall household expenses are below the national average.

Demographic facts
for Pullman, MI 49450

Pullman, MI 49450 has a population of 3,257 people in 1,215 households with a median age of 38.6 years old.
